Nate Graham, a developer engaged in quality control in the KDE project, published the latest report on the development of KDE. The development of the KDE Plasma 6.4 branch, with a planned release date of June 17, has reached the soft freeze stage, where changes are limited to implementing new features.
Among the recent changes in KDE Frameworks 6.16:
- The design of typical dialogs “New File” and “New Folder” used in Dolphin on the desktop and in various applications has been updated. Users can now assign their own icon catalog.
- Added protection against interruption of file transfer by entering sleep mode, which is now blocked until the operation is completed.
- The mechanism for drawing the icons of the Kirigami framework in KDE Plasma and QtQuick applications has been improved to address issues in dark design mode.
- Thumbnail display for files on external servers requested via URL has been enhanced.
Improvements in KDE Plasma 6.4:
- The volume control widget now shows the name of the content being played in applications that provide metadata.
